JAVAWEb从入门到精通第二十八章07公共类设计.ppt
-
资源ID:6509531
资源大小:305.49KB
全文页数:5页
- 资源格式: PPT
下载积分:15金币
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
|
JAVAWEb从入门到精通第二十八章07公共类设计.ppt
公共类设计,本讲大纲:,1、Item公共类,2、数据模型公共类,3、Dao公共类,Item公共类,Item公共类是对数据表最常用的id和name属性的封装,用于Swing列表、表格、下拉列表框等组件的赋值。该类重写了toString()方法,在该方法中只输出name属性,所以Item类在Swing组件显示文本时只包含名称信息,不会连带着id属性。但是,在获取组件的内容时,获取的是Item类的对象,从该对象中可以很容易地获取id属性,然后通过该属性到数据库中获取唯一的数据。,数据模型公共类,在包中存放的是数据模型公共类,它们对应着数据库中不同的数据表,这些模型将被访问数据库的Dao类和程序中各个模块甚至各个组件所使用。和Item公共类的使用方法类似,数据模型也是对数据表中所有字段(属性)的封装,但是数据模型是纯粹的模型类,它不但需要重写父类的toString()方法,还要重写hashCode()方法和equals()方法(这两个方法分别用于生成模型对象的哈希代码和判断模型对象是否相同)。模型类主要用于存储数据,并通过相应的getXXX()方法和setXXX()方法实现不同属性的访问原则。,Dao公共类,Dao的全称是Data Access Object,即数据访问对象。本项目中应用该名称作为数据库访问类的名称,在该类中实现了数据库的驱动、连接、关闭和多个操作数据库的方法,这些方法包括不同数据表的操作方法。在介绍具体的数据库访问方法之前,先来看一下Dao类的定义,也就是数据库驱动和连接的代码。,Thank you,